Abstract

Cupressus arizonica composed from several compounds such as quinones, flavonoids, saponins, terpenes,, tannins and phenolic compounds. polyphenolic compounds considerable as antioxidant potentials which related to the human health. The ethyl 95% extract of Cupressus arizonica in different concentrations were measured inhibited against five bacterial isolates (E. coli, Klebsiella pneumonia, Aeromonas sp., Salmonella sp. and Staphylococcus aureus) from different sites of human body. and measured this inhibitory effect with different antibiotic discs such as (Ciprofloxacin 10 µg, Norfloxacin (10 µg), Vancomycin (30µg), Lincomycin (15µg), Imipenem (10 µg) and (25 µg), Lincomycin (15µg) and Trimethoprim /Sulfamethaxazole (25 µg). Cupressus arizonica fruit ethyl extract in 100% concentration toward different species of bacteria like E. coli, Klebsiella pneumonia, Aeromonas sp, Salmonella sp and Staphylococcus aureus. At different inhibition zones 11, 25,10,15, 21 µg/ ml respectively for each one of them compared with some antibiotics were used in this study.Minimum Inhibitory Concentration (MIC) of Cupressus arizonica ethanol extract for bacteria E.coli, Klebsiella pneumonia, Aeromonas sp., Salmonella sp. and Staphylococcus aureus. The MIC of Cupressus arizonica affected on E.coli Klebsiella pneumonia, Aeromonas sp. and Staphylococcus aureus were 12.5 µg/ ml. The MIC of Cupressus arizonica ethanol extract for Salmonella sp. was at 50 µg/ ml. the inhibition means of Cupressus arizonica fruit alcoholic extract toward bacterial isolates recorded lowest mean 8.6 at concentration 75% against E. coli bacteria, but the highest mean was at 21 at concentration 100% towards Staphylococcus aureus, while other concentration means distributed among bacterial isolates in different effects.
